Why is the following sentence ineffective?

"I have recently become qualified for this job. I was also a good worker at my last job."


Sagot :

Final answer:

The provided sentence lacks clarity and conciseness. It's crucial to highlight quantifiable skills and maintain parallel structure for effective professional writing.


Explanation:

Mixed Sentence Structure: The sentence provided is ineffective due to its poor structure and lack of clarity. A more concise and effective sentence would focus on the specific qualifications and achievements that make the individual a strong candidate.
Quantifiable Skills: It's essential to highlight quantifiable skills and achievements in job applications to showcase expertise. Using active verbs and omitting pronouns like 'I' and 'me' can make the content more impactful.
Parallelism: Ensuring parallel structure in sentences is crucial for coherence and effectiveness. Maintaining consistent verb tenses and structures is key in professional writing.
